Post by puffin » Mon Jun 18, 2007 8:00 pm

I would also say this reads Temperance

It is interesting that the image is no longer available and perhaps is being re-done.

Recently I have had several illegible images on the scotlandspeople website ( completely bleached out or over exposed with barely nothing legible) but if you complete the relevant form form on the website to request the information for which you have paid there is efficient response and they will forward to you a clear photocopy of the entry.
